‘Britain's ugliest dog’ Peggy to star as Dogpool in Deadpool & Wolverine

The upcoming MCU film starring Ryan Reynolds and Hugh Jackman is slated to release on July 26

Britain’s ugliest dog title winner Peggy is set to star as Dogpool in the upcoming MCU film Deadpool & Wolverine, actor Ryan Reynolds told UK-based magazine Empire in a recent interview, calling the canine an animal manifestation of Deadpool’s alter-ego Wade Wilson.

“The reason why I was a huge proponent for her was because she feels like the animal manifestation of Wade Wilson,” Reynolds said in the interview.

Initially introduced in a 2010 Marvel comic book, Dogpool emerged as "a tiny little afterthought" during the writing process of Deadpool & Wolverine, gradually evolving into a significant element as production progressed, becoming a staple within the film, said Reynolds.

Deadpool & Wolverine, slated to release on July 26, follows Reynolds’ Deadpool and Hugh Jackman’s Logan as they embark on a mission against Charles Xavier's evil twin Cassandra Nova.

On December 5 last year, Reynolds shared a still of him and Peggy, a cross between a Chinese crested breed and a pug, from Deadpool & Wolverine on Instagram. Peggy also has a dedicated Instagram handle by the name Dogpool.

“That’s a wrap on my first movie! We worked our pants off but it was worth it. Everyone on set was the utmost professional, especially Shawn Levy and Hugh Jackman. And a super-hero big bow-wow-WOW to the entire crew. No matter the challenge, you rose to the task and made it look easy. I wouldn’t change a thing. Except maybe one person who was a little extra to deal with. But don’t worry, I’ve forgiven him. I even left him a very special warm, personal gift in his trailer,” reads a post shared on Peggy’s official Instagram handle on January 24.

The trailer for the upcoming film showcases high-octane action sequences featuring Deadpool and Wolverine combating Cassandra and other villains before leaping into what seems like a magical portal.
